Gabelli Funds LLC Lowers Position in Pfizer Inc. $PFE

Gabelli Funds LLC decreased its stake in shares of Pfizer Inc. (NYSE:PFEFree Report) by 11.8% in the 1st qu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the SEC. The fund owned 508,600 shares of the biopharmaceutical company’s stock after selling 67,900 shares during the period. Gabelli Funds LLC’s holdings in Pfizer were worth $14,281,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Analyst Upgrades and Downgrades

A number of equities analysts have recently commented on the company. Guggenheim cut their price objective on Pfizer from $36.00 to $35.00 and set a “buy” rating on the stock in a report on Monday, July 13th. UBS Group reiterated a “neutral” rating and set a $27.00 target price on shares of Pfizer in a report on Wednesday, May 27th. Citigroup increased their target price on shares of Pfizer from $26.00 to $27.00 and gave the stock a “neutral” rating in a research report on Wednesday, April 29th. Royal Bank Of Canada upgraded shares of Pfizer from an “underperform” rating to a “sector perform” rating and set a $25.00 price target on the stock in a report on Tuesday, June 9th. Finally, Wolfe Research reaffirmed an “underperform” rating and set a $26.00 price target on shares of Pfizer in a research report on Thursday, May 14th. One investment analyst has rated the stock with a Strong Buy rating, four have assigned a Buy rating, fourteen have assigned a Hold rating and two have assigned a Sell rating to the company’s stock. According to data from MarketBeat.com, the company presently has a consensus rating of “Hold” and an average target price of $28.50.

Pfizer Trading Down 0.1%

NYSE:PFE opened at $24.52 on Monday. The business’s 50-day moving average is $25.11 and its two-hundred day moving average is $26.17.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.67, a current ratio of 1.25 and a quick ratio of 0.94. Pfizer Inc. has a 12 month low of $23.11 and a 12 month high of $28.75. The firm has a market capitalization of $139.78 billion, a PE ratio of 18.72 and a beta of 0.35.

Pfizer (NYSE:PFEG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, May 5th. The biopharmaceutical company reported $0.75 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.72 by $0.03. Pfizer had a return on equity of 19.44% and a net margin of 11.83%.The company had revenue of $14.45 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$13.84 billion. During the same quarter in the previous year, the firm posted $0.92 earnings per share. The firm’s quarterly revenue was up 5.4% on a year-over-year basis. Pfizer has set its FY 2026 guidance at 2.800-3.000 EPS. Research analysts predict that Pfizer Inc. will post 2.96 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Pfizer Dividend Announcement

The business also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Tuesday, September 1st. Shareholders of record on Friday, July 24th will be issued a $0.43 dividend. This represents a $1.72 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 7.0%. The ex-dividend date is Friday, July 24th. Pfizer’s dividend payout ratio is currently 131.30%.

Pfizer Company Profile

(Free Report)

Pfizer Inc (NYSE: PFE) is a multinational biopharmaceutical company headquartered in New York City. Founded in 1849 by Charles Pfizer and Charles Erhart, the company researches, develops, manufactures and commercializes a broad range of medicines and vaccines for human health. Its activities span discovery research, clinical development, regulatory affairs, manufacturing and global commercial distribution across multiple therapeutic areas.

Pfizer’s portfolio and pipeline cover oncology, immunology, cardiology, endocrinology, rare diseases, hospital acute care and anti-infectives, along with a substantial vaccine business.
